Exciting Opportunity at MSK: Are you passionate about financial operations and vendor relations in a research-driven environment? MSK is seeking a Procurement / Billing Analyst to join our Research Facilities, specifically supporting our Animal Research Center. This is a unique opportunity to contribute to groundbreaking research by ensuring efficient procurement and financial processes.

As an Analyst, you will play a key role in maintaining strong relationships with vendors and ensuring smooth procurement and invoice activities. Reporting to a Senior Financial Analyst, you'll work collaboratively within a dynamic team to manage departmental expenses, reconcile inter-institutional activity, and support financial operations across our core facilities.

Role Overview:

  • Liaises between institutional investigators and vendors to coordinate and execute the importing and exporting of non-commercial animal requisitions.

  • Processes all animal purchase requisitions within the proprietary web-based ordering system.

  • Updates ordering requisition data to reflect order cancellations, price changes, and other adjustments.

  • Manages shipping of non-commercial quarantine animal importation and exportation. Coordinates with core staff, shipping companies, and shipping receiving institutions to ensure that animals are delivered in a compliant manner.

  • Reviews and verifies all information and confirms orders with vendor(s) and outside agencies and institutions.

  • Coordinates billing and purchasing documentation and notifies the appropriate staff of any discrepancies or problems.

  • Coordinates the shipment and receipt of goods and services

  • Maintains databases for vendors and strains. Provides receiving information to core leadership for various reports and projections as needed. Maintains department records, including logs and paperwork for orders.

  • Serve as thefirst point of contact for core staff and vendors regarding the procurement processes.
